which connector is what

so my 87 base with stick, has two connectors by the passenger side strut tower/air box, one is green with three pins and the other is white with two pins.
Which one am I supposed to jump for the fuel pump and which is for the tps calibration?some people have said that the fuel pump test connector is green, some have said yellow, some have said white, which is it?

The Fuel PUmp Check Connector is YELLOW. It has one black and one brown wire. It came from the factory with a black rubber covering around it. That's from the factory service manual, 1987 and all my series four are that color.
